Ever since the Bondi Blue iMac debuted in 1998, Apple’s all-in-one desktop computer has been setting standards in gorgeous design and powerful performance. And Apple’s April 2021 Spring Loaded event delivered the new, colourful 24in iMac, available in Green, Yellow, Orange, Pink, Purple, Blue, and Silver. The larger screen has also been bumped up to a 4.5K Retina display with a 4480x2520 resolution.
Inside, Apple’s own M1 chip combines with macOS Monterey, and Apple promises up to 85% faster CPU performance and up to two times faster graphics performance than the 21.5-inch iMac models. All the models come with 8GB of unified memory (upgradeable to 16GB). The 8-core CPU/7-core GPU option comes with a 256GB SSD (configurable to 512GB or 1TB). The 8-core CPU/8-core GPU versions come with either a 256GB or 512GB SSD and can be upgraded to 1TB or 2TB.
